Fairhaven's Siding Takes a Different Kind of Beating
Fairhaven sits close enough to Bellingham Bay that salt-laden air is a daily fact of life, not an occasional nuisance. Add in the driving, wind-pushed rain that rolls through Whatcom County for much of the year and a moss and algae season that can stretch from fall through spring, and you have a climate that quietly stresses siding in ways drier inland neighborhoods never see. Homes here don't usually fail all at once. They fail one soft spot, one hairline crack, one moss-choked shadow line at a time, until an owner finally notices paint bubbling near a window trim or a board that flexes under a thumb.
Siding repair in this neighborhood isn't just patch-and-paint work. It's diagnosing what the salt air, moisture, and shade have actually done to the wall assembly behind the surface, then fixing it so the same failure doesn't reappear in two winters.

What the Local Climate Does to Siding Over Time
Salt Air
Airborne salt accelerates corrosion on fasteners, flashing, and any exposed metal trim. On siding materials that rely on paint film for protection, salt exposure also breaks down that film faster than it would a few miles inland, which is part of why homes closer to the water tend to need attention sooner.
Driving Rain
Wind-driven rain doesn't just fall on siding, it gets pushed sideways into joints, laps, and butt seams. Over years, caulking that was never designed to be a primary water barrier starts to fail, and water finds its way behind the cladding at the exact spots builders assumed would stay dry.
Moss and Algae
Shaded walls, north-facing elevations, and anything near overhanging trees stay damp longer here than in sunnier climates. That constant moisture supports moss and algae growth, which holds water against the siding surface and, on wood-based products, can accelerate rot at the exact spots the growth takes hold.
Common Repair Issues We See on Fairhaven Homes
- Soft, spongy, or delaminating boards at the bottom courses, where splash-back and standing moisture concentrate
- Cracked or split siding near window and door trim, often from a combination of moisture cycling and material movement
- Failed caulk joints that have opened up gaps at seams, corners, and penetrations
- Moss and algae staining that keeps a wall damp longer than a clean, sun-exposed wall
- Rust streaking from corroding fasteners or metal flashing, a giveaway of a moisture and salt-air combination at work
- Paint failure and peeling that's outpacing the rest of the house, usually a sign moisture is moving through the siding from behind
What a Correct Repair Actually Involves
A lot of siding "repair" in this climate is really just cosmetic patching over a moisture problem that keeps working underneath. That's how the same repair ends up needed again 18 months later. A repair worth paying for starts with finding out why the siding failed in the first place, not just what it looks like on the surface.
Step One: Diagnose, Don't Just Patch
Before any board comes off, we look at what's driving the damage: is water getting behind the siding at a flashing detail, a caulk joint, or a penetration for a hose bib or vent? Is the damage isolated to one section or is it a pattern across a whole elevation? Patching a symptom without fixing the water path behind it is the single most common reason siding repairs don't hold up.
Step Two: Open It Up and Check the Wall Behind It
Once we know where the damage is concentrated, we remove the affected siding and inspect the water-resistive barrier, flashing, and sheathing underneath. Any homeowner who's had a "quick fix" siding repair that reappeared knows the reason: nobody checked what was happening behind the cladding.
Step Three: Repair the Details, Not Just the Boards
Correct flashing at windows, doors, and penetrations, proper lap and joint spacing, and the right fasteners for a coastal climate all matter more than the siding material itself. Skipping these details is how a repair looks fine for a season and fails again by the next wet winter.
Step Four: Match and Finish
Replacement sections need to match the existing siding's profile, exposure, and color as closely as possible. On factory-finished fiber cement, that's straightforward because the color is baked into the product rather than mixed on site. On field-painted materials, matching an aged finish is harder and often means repainting a full elevation to avoid a visible patch.
Repair or Replace? How We Help You Decide
Not every problem area needs a full re-side, but not every problem is a good candidate for a spot repair either. The table below covers the factors we actually weigh on a Fairhaven job site.
| Factor | Favors Repair | Favors Replacement |
|---|---|---|
| Extent of damage | Isolated to one or two elevations or sections | Spread across most of the house |
| Underlying wall condition | Sheathing and barrier are sound where opened up | Rot or moisture damage found behind multiple sections |
| Siding age | Siding is well within its expected service life | Siding is near or past the end of its useful life |
| Material match | Replacement material and finish can be matched closely | Discontinued profile, color, or product line |
| Root cause | Cause was a single failed detail (caulk, flashing) now correctable | Cause is systemic (design, ventilation, chronic moss/moisture) |
When damage is limited and the wall behind it checks out sound, a targeted repair is the honest, cost-effective answer. When we find the same failure pattern repeating across the house, or the existing siding is already near the end of what it can give, we'll tell you that plainly rather than stringing together patches that won't hold.

What Homeowners Can Do Between Repairs
- Rinse moss and algae growth off siding gently at least once a year, especially on shaded or north-facing walls
- Trim back trees and shrubs that keep siding shaded and slow to dry after rain
- Check caulk at windows, doors, and trim joints annually and have gaps re-caulked before they widen
- Watch for soft spots, bubbling paint, or discoloration low on the wall, which often show up before damage is visible elsewhere
- Keep gutters and downspouts clear so roof water isn't dumping directly onto siding below
- Address small repairs promptly rather than waiting, since moisture damage in this climate tends to spread, not stay contained
